E.G. Phillips
Signals in the Dark   ​

Picture
photo credit: Sonya Herrera
San Francisco's E.G. Phillips has returned with his brand new EP, Signals in the Dark. It is a record that Phillips himself describes as "an album that
unfolds like a series of intercepted transmissions, intimate, imperfect and searching — drifting between late-night jazz clubs, strained conversations, and imagined places of refuge."

Starting things off with Empathy for the Night Fly, E.G. Phillips sets the tone for the rest of the EP. The solitary trumpet making way for Phillips' comfortingly gravelly vocals kick in as the jazz-infused instrumentals draw you in to the story with each silky smooth note. 
Picture
The album feels like E.G. Phillips has taken the time to craft each track as a standalone piece rather than writing them to make an album. That has enable him to create many varied musical soundscapes, from the swinging sounds of The Musical I Still Adore to the guitar led Tahiti, Make Me a Latte, that closes the album. 

E.G. Phillips has real knack for story telling and his style of music is the perfect platform to tell his tales of relationships, painting pictures in the mind for each individual track, from cafes to the moon. His musical style is incredibly versatile, easily switching from full on jazz to the rockier Radio Silence Mode.  


Produced by Chris McGrew and Kevin Seal at Hyde Street Studios in San Francisco, Signals in the Dark is out and available to stream right now. So, why not give your ears a bit of change and discover the vivid storytelling of E.G. Phillips.
